Novel solid-state synthesis of halide free alane
The traditional aluminum hydride (alane, AlH3) synthesis involves reacting AlCl3 and LiAlH4 in diethyl ether, resulting in the formation of the alane etherate adduct, AlH3·h[(C2H5)2O].
